WebJan 12, 2024 · Local Beer and Farm Animals: Throwback Brewery. A flight of local beers at Throwback Brewery near Portsmouth, NH. The Portsmouth area has been a hub for the brewing industry ever since Frank Jones began brewing ale in 1858. By 1882, The Frank Jones Brewery was the largest in the country, producing 250,000 barrels of beer annually.
